7. Introduction<br />

One goal of the Alcotra Project is to identify best <strong>practices</strong> in order to support the regions in the take up<br />

and development of their respective <strong>Living</strong> <strong>Labs</strong>. However since the <strong>Living</strong> Lab concept as such is rather<br />

new and only few <strong>Living</strong> Lab are actually older than 4 years it is very difficult to identify best <strong>practices</strong> in this<br />

area. The best solutions to find best practice <strong>Living</strong> <strong>Labs</strong> is thus to utilize the experiences which has been<br />

gathered as part of the European Network of <strong>Living</strong> <strong>Labs</strong> (ENoLL) were a lot of <strong>Living</strong> <strong>Labs</strong> are partners in.<br />

ENoLL is a non-profit organisation where a lot of <strong>Living</strong> <strong>Labs</strong> cooperate and exchange, thus leading to a<br />

good portfolio of case studies. Un<strong>for</strong>tunately these case studies are on the one hand highly diverse<br />

regarding there thematic orientation and secondly not yet categorized in a clear manner. Thus there is<br />

currently no general mechanism applied on how to measure the quality and per<strong>for</strong>mance of the <strong>Living</strong> <strong>Labs</strong><br />

inside ENoLL. The only indication that exists about the success of a <strong>Living</strong> Lab is its capability to be<br />

sustainable over a certain period of time. As part of the EU projects Corelabs and CO-L<strong>Labs</strong> a database was<br />

developed which consists out of the application in<strong>for</strong>mation that was submitted to the ENoLL in the<br />

respective calls <strong>for</strong> <strong>Living</strong> Lab membership. On the basis of this in<strong>for</strong>mation a DB was developed which<br />

currently at least allows to search through the application <strong>for</strong>ms to identify keywords etc. <strong>for</strong> research<br />

purposes.<br />
